Transaction 5877fe7057c7e2b8dd86eac071963c044a861063b3a8741ced729de498a8bbcb
1 Input
2 Outputs
- 5877fe7057c7e2b8dd86eac071963c044a861063b3a8741ced729de498a8bbcb:0
- 5877fe7057c7e2b8dd86eac071963c044a861063b3a8741ced729de498a8bbcb:1
value 3485520
address 1EGqkR67xzX2d17CAUScd8SHyqskJvEBsM
value 2292757318
address 3BvsWCLsmU7nGCdxfDnd3JASDVRNNjmoqL